Yevgeny Alexandrowitsch Ryschkow ( Russian Евгений Александрович Рыжков ; born May 15, 1985 in Karagandy ) is a Kazakh swimmer .

In 2004 Yevgeny Ryschkow was able to qualify for the Olympic Games , but was disqualified in 200 m medley. Ryschkow also took part in the next Olympic Games with Kazakhstan , where he took 35th place in the 100 m chest and 25th place in the 200 m chest. At the short course world championships in 2006 he won the bronze medal in the 200 m breaststroke with 02: 07.94.
